The College of Veterinary Medicine at the University of Basrah is on the Verge of Achieving Full Program Accreditation
In an unprecedented historical achievement, the College of Veterinary Medicine at the University of Basrah is preparing to receive "full program accreditation," confirming its pioneering status as the first Iraqi college to achieve this distinction in record time.
The Dean of the College, Dr. Jalal Yassin Mustafa, announced the college's complete readiness to receive the ministerial committee, following the completion of quality indicators and the discussion and official approval of the Quality Assurance Division's report.
He pointed out that this distinction solidifies the college's position, having previously earned program accreditation as the first veterinary medicine college in Iraq, paving the way for a new era of academic excellence. He also emphasized that this achievement represents a qualitative leap for the University of Basrah, placing Iraqi higher education at the forefront of international quality standards with purely national competence.
